> +     <refpurpose>14-bit Bayer formats expanded to 16 bits</refpurpose>
> +      </refnamediv>
> +      <refsect1>
> +     <title>Description</title>
> +
> +     <para>These four pixel formats are raw sRGB / Bayer formats with
> +14 bits per colour. Each colour component is stored in a 16-bit word, with 2
> +unused high bits filled with zeros. Each n-pixel row contains n/2 green 
> samples
> +and n/2 blue or red samples, with alternating red and blue rows. Bytes are
> +stored in memory in little endian order. They are conventionally described
> +as GRGR... BGBG..., RGRG... GBGB..., etc. Below is an example of one of these
> +formats</para>
